Student Engagement Photographer (FWS/NFWS)
Apply locations AZ Phoenix time type Part time posted on Posted Yesterday job requisition id R000062231Grand Canyon University is seeking a photographer to support the mission of Grand Canyon University through GCU's Student Engagement department.
Position Summary/Purpose
Produce high quality photographs of the various Student Engagement events as well as working alongside student leaders to create marketing materials to advertise these events.

Primary Responsibilities
Provide photography for the Student Engagement Department.
Attend and photograph for Student Engagement events using professional equipment (provided).
Capture photos and edit using software programs: Photoshop, Lightroom.
Reach out to other students interested in photography projects.
Upload photos to shared server/file location where marketing staff have access to them.
Meet regularly with Project Coordinator and student leaders to receive feedback or changes, review upcoming events, assignments, and communication strategies.
Occasionally attend client meetings with the Coordinator.
Maintain a strict schedule for completed tasks as requested by clients.
Equipment Used and Responsibility
MS Office
Canon Camera
Adobe Lightroom
Qualifications
Must have a high level of technical skill in specified field.
Experience in photography using professional equipment.
Proficient in photo editing software programs.
Able to take and receive direction from Student Engagement staff for vision.
Able to work well with others in achieving the common goal of highlighting and marketing Student Engagement events.
Provide a photography portfolio.
Experience/Education
Grand Canyon University is committed to a student first policy.
Therefore, all applicants must meet the following eligibility requirements to be considered for student employment:
- Enrolled at GCU as a full-time student in a Bachelors program or Masters program.
- Retain a 2.0 GPA as a Bachelor level student or a 3.0 GPA as a Master level student.
- Maintain good financial and academic (SAP) standing with the University.
You may be subject to termination if you fall below the minimum requirements.
Hourly Pay Rate: Minimum Wage
Anticipated End Date: June 30, 2026
